Financial Statements
Compiled reports detailing a company's financial status, including balance sheets, income statements, and more.
Loan Request
A formal application to a lender asking for funds to be borrowed under specified terms.
Classified Balance Sheet
A financial statement that groups assets, liabilities, and equity into subcategories, providing detail and clarity to financial positions.
